The Electrical Commissioning & Startup Technician provides on-site leadership and technical expertise for the safe commissioning, testing, and startup of electrical systems across new plants, retrofit projects, and turnarounds. Supporting Air Products' facilities throughout the Americas, this role focuses on utilities and power generation systems, ensuring reliable construction and startup across technologies such as hydrogen, syngas, gasification, ammonia, and ASU plants. The technician will lead electrical testing, implement safety procedures, tackle electrical and instrumentation equipment, and collaborate closely with Engineering, Operations, and global CSU teams. The role requires significant travel (80-85%), strong handson field experience, proficiency with electrical testing equipment and standards (NEC, NFPA 70E, NETA), and the ability to mentor site teams. Successful candidates will complete an 18-24month qualification program and help drive consistent global commissioning practices.

Minimum Hiring Requirements:
  • High School diploma or equivalent experience and formal technical training in electrical construction, maintenance, and testing is required.
  • 5 years of experience in the Electrical Operations or Commissioning Field.
  • Good written and verbal communication skills
  • Broad knowledge of technologies supported, electrical standards, electrical safety systems, and engineering and operating procedures a plus.
  • Able to work in a team environment and maintain a positive disposition even in times of high stress and workload.
  • Tackle and make good and timely decisions in high stress situations.
  • Demonstrated ability to operate, commission, startup, solve, assess, and resolve various plant related issues.
  • Interpret single line diagrams, three-line diagrams, control schematics, construction drawings/ details, and other electrical user documentation.
  • Experience and shown understanding of electrical construction and industry standards such as NFPA 70 National Electrical Code (NEC) and NFPA 70E Standard for Electrical Safety in the Workplace
  • Experience, and knowledge of electrical distribution system equipment.
  • Experience with setting up and programming various electrical protection relays, particularly SEL and Multilin
  • Experience with electrical testing and procedures as well national testing standards (NETA) and test equipment including, but not limited to, multi-function meter, insulation resistance tester (megger), low resistance ohmmeter (Ductor), high potential dielectric withstand equipment (hi-pot), current injection units and sweep frequency response analysis (SFRA) equipment
  • Working, hands-on experience, and troubleshooting knowledge of E&I equipment including: DCS systems, Fiber optic communications, low voltage (<600V) switchgear, low voltage motor control centers, low and medium voltage induction motors, diesel generators, low voltage power and control cables, DC battery systems, uninterruptible power supplies, and electrical protection relays.
